Arkansas Democratic Party chairman Bill Gwatney died in Little Rock, Arkansas, on August 13, 2008 after being shot three times at the Arkansas Democratic Party headquarters earlier that day. The suspect, who reportedly fired three shots before fleeing the scene, was later captured and fatally shot by police.
